What does AgNext Technologies do vs Pinecone?
AgNext Technologies: AgNext Technologies develops AI-powered quality assessment solutions for the agriculture and food supply chain industry, using near-infrared spectroscopy, computer vision, and machine learning to deliver rapid, non-destructive grading of grains, oilseeds, spices, and other agricultural commodities at procurement centers, ports, and processing facilities. The platform enables buyers and processors to standardize quality assessment and reduce adulteration across complex supply chains.\n\nThe company raised approximately $10M in Series B funding and has deployed its AgriSpec and QualEx products at government procurement agencies, commodity exchanges, large agri-processors, and export-oriented food companies across India and internationally. AgNext's devices replace subjective manual inspection with objective, data-driven quality measurements.\n\nFood quality and adulteration are persistent problems in India's agricultural supply chain, with significant economic and public health consequences. AgNext's technology addresses a regulatory and commercial imperative, and its deployments at government procurement operations provide both revenue stability and strong validation of the technology's accuracy in field conditions. Pinecone: Pinecone is a vector database platform founded in 2019 that enables developers to build and deploy AI applications using vector embeddings. The company provides a fully managed cloud service that indexes and searches high-dimensional vector data at scale, serving as critical infrastructure for ret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) and other machine learning workflows. Pinecone's core offering allows applications to store, index, and query embeddings generated from text, images, and other data types, facilitating semantic search and similarity matching capabilities essential for modern AI systems. The platform operates in the rapidly expanding vector database market, competing with alternatives including Weaviate, Milvus, and cloud provider solutions. Pinecone's approach emphasizes ease of use through a serverless architecture that abstracts infrastructure complexity, targeting developers building generative AI applications without deep database expertise. The company has achieved significant adoption among enterprises and startups applying large language models for production systems. As of the latest disclosed information, Pinecone has raised $138 million in funding and holds a valuation of $800 million. The company remains in Series B stage, indicating substantial market validation while operating in the pre-profitability phase typical of infrastructure software companies. Its growth trajectory reflects increasing demand for vector storage solutions as enterprises integrate AI models into production workflows.
